Defining "Regular Basis": Beyond Simple Repetition



The phrase "regular basis" implies consistent and frequent repetition of an action or event. However, the term's true power lies in its inherent flexibility. What constitutes "regular" differs significantly depending on context. For a daily medication regimen, "regular" means once or several times a day; for a gardener, it might mean weekly watering and monthly fertilization; for a writer, it could signify daily writing sessions or weekly article submissions. The key is defining a frequency that suits the specific task and its desired outcome while maintaining consistency.

The Importance of Regularity in Different Contexts:



1. Physical Health: Regular exercise, a balanced diet, and sufficient sleep are cornerstones of good health. Regularity isn't about intense, sporadic efforts; it's about consistent, sustainable habits. For example, a 30-minute walk most days is more beneficial than a grueling 3-hour workout once a month. Similarly, consistently choosing healthy food options over sporadic indulgence leads to more sustainable weight management and improved overall health.

2. Mental Well-being: Regular mindfulness practices, such as meditation or deep breathing exercises, can significantly reduce stress and improve mental clarity. Similarly, engaging in hobbies or activities you enjoy on a regular basis can boost mood and provide a sense of accomplishment. Even scheduling regular "me-time" can drastically improve mental well-being. Imagine the difference between sporadic bursts of reading versus dedicating 30 minutes each evening to a book.

3. Professional Success: Regular work habits, such as consistent time management, proactive planning, and continuous learning, are crucial for career advancement. Regularly updating skills through online courses or workshops, for example, demonstrates commitment and keeps professionals competitive. Similarly, setting aside time each day for focused work, instead of sporadic bursts of activity, improves concentration and productivity.

4. Relationship Building: Regular communication and quality time are vital for maintaining healthy relationships. Regular phone calls, planned outings, or even small gestures of appreciation go a long way in strengthening bonds. The contrast between sporadic grand gestures and consistent, small acts of kindness is profound – the latter fosters a more enduring connection.

5. Personal Growth: Regular self-reflection, goal setting, and pursuing learning opportunities are fundamental for personal development. Regularly journaling, for instance, allows for introspection and identifies areas for improvement. Similarly, consistently reviewing and adjusting personal goals helps to ensure steady progress towards self-improvement.

Implementing Regularity: Strategies and Tips



Establishing regular habits requires conscious effort and strategic planning. Start small, focusing on one or two areas at a time. Use tools like planners, calendars, and apps to schedule activities and track progress. Find accountability partners or join groups to support your efforts. Remember to be flexible and forgiving; setbacks are inevitable, but consistency is key. Celebrate small victories to stay motivated.

FAQs:



1. What if I miss a day or two of my regular routine? Don't get discouraged! Missing a day or two is normal. The key is to get back on track as soon as possible and not let it derail your entire system.

2. How do I choose the right frequency for my regular activities? Experiment and find what works best for you. Start with a frequency you can realistically maintain and adjust as needed.

3. How can I stay motivated to maintain a regular routine? Find an accountability partner, reward yourself for milestones, and focus on the long-term benefits.

4. Is it better to focus on many regular activities or a few? It's better to start with a few and master those before adding more. Overwhelm can lead to inconsistency.

5. Can a regular routine be flexible and adaptable? Absolutely! Life throws curveballs. Build flexibility into your routine, allowing for adjustments when needed, but maintain the core principles of consistency and regularity.
